在企业生产环境中使用的脚本,一般会定义一个exit退出状态码。
检测什么并不重要,重要的是环境标准化要求脚本只能执行一次,第二次执行将会出现错误。所以会定义exit退出状态码防止脚本循环执行。例如:
1 | rpm -q salt |
上面的示例意思是:如果salt存在,则退出脚本,退出状态码100。因为首次执行的时候是没有salt软件的,软件在脚本的下面才会安装。
- 本文作者: GaryWu
- 本文链接: https://garywu520.github.io/2017/08/18/exit退出状态码的另类应用/
- 版权声明: 本博客所有文章除特别声明外,均采用 MIT 许可协议。转载请注明出处!